云服务器网:购买云服务器和VPS必上的网站!

SQL Server没法启动:排查故障的步骤

SQL Server是Microsoft公司开发出来的一种最流行的关系数据库,广泛用于软件开发,大多数企业都在使用它。
但是,SQL Server有时会出现启动问题,禁止用户完成一切数据库操作。查找和解决SQL Server启动问题多是一个辣手的任务,特别是对

SQL Server是Microsoft公司开发出来的一种最流行的关系数据库,广泛用于软件开发,大多数企业都在使用它。

但是,SQL Server有时会出现启动问题,禁止用户完成一切数据库操作。查找和解决SQL Server启动问题多是一个辣手的任务,特别是对初学者来讲。

本文将介绍SQL Server没法启动的故障排查步骤,以帮助您找出和解决问题。

## 一、检查服务状态

一开始检查SQL Server服务状态是排查故障的第一步,可以从控制面板-> 查看服务 来查看。服务启动失败,没有自行启动,则多是由于服务设置、操作系统设置或更新致使的。

也能够使用以下SQL语句查看服务状态:

“`sql

EXEC xp_regread

@rootkey=’HKEY_LOCAL_MACHINE’,

@key=’SYSTEM\CurrentControlSet\Services\MSsqlserver’,

@value_name=’Start’


如果启动值为“2”,则说明SQL Server服务已启动;如果启动值为“3”,则表示SQL Server服务没有启动。

## 二、检查SQL Server日志文件

如果SQL Server没法启动或实例启动失败,一般会在Windows事件日志或SQL Server毛病日志中反应出来。

如果发现SQL Server实例关闭,则可以在Windows事件日志中找到毛病编号,再根据该毛病编号查找毛病信息,以查明缘由。

在SQL Server毛病日志中可以查看更详细的问题,以便找出解决SQL Server启动问题的根本缘由。

## 三、其他缘由

除以上2种情况,还有一些可能会致使SQL Server不能启动的缘由,如系统环境不正确、硬件出现故障等。这类问题需要检查系统环境会不会正确,或重新构建数据库,或更新硬件等。

## 四、总结

以上就是SQL Server没法启动时排查故障的步骤。例如查看服务状态,检查Windows事件日志,检查SQL Server日志文件等。有些问题还需要检查系统环境,或重新构建数据库,或更新硬件等。在检查进程中可以帮助定位并解决SQL Server启动问题,从而使您的数据库正常运行。

本文来源:https://www.yuntue.com/post/111081.html | 云服务器网,转载请注明出处!

关于作者: yuntue

云服务器(www.yuntue.com)是一家专门做阿里云服务器代金券、腾讯云服务器优惠券的网站,这里你可以找到阿里云服务器腾讯云服务器等国内主流云服务器优惠价格,以及海外云服务器、vps主机等优惠信息,我们会为你提供性价比最高的云服务器和域名、数据库、CDN、免费邮箱等企业常用互联网资源。

为您推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注